IN THE MATTER OF

the Utilities Commission Act, R.S.B.C. 1996, Chapter 473

 

and

 

An Application by Pacific Northern Gas (N.E.) Ltd.

for Approval to Increase Allowable Indebtedness under Pacific Northern Gas’s Revolving Credit Facility

 

 

BEFORE:               L. F. Kelsey, Commissioner                                          June 17, 2010

                                D. A. Cote, Commissioner

 

 

O  R  D  E  R

 

WHEREAS:

 

A.      On October 22, 2009, Pacific Northern Gas Ltd. (PNG) applied to the British Columbia Utilities Commission (the Commission) for approval  under sections 50 and 52 of the Utilities Commission Act (the Act) to enter into a committed five-year term revolving credit facility with Roynat Inc. and Canadian Western Bank in the principal amount of $35 million (the Revolving Credit Facility) with $12 million to be utilized for backstopping an intercompany revolving credit facility with its subsidiary Pacific Northern Gas (N.E.) Ltd. [PNG (N.E.)]; and

 

B.      On October 22, 2009, PNG (N.E.) applied to the Commission for approval under section 50 of the Act to enter into a five-year term revolving credit facility with PNG in the principal amount of $12 million (the PNG Revolving Credit Facility); and

 

C.      On December 3, 2009 the Commission approved the Revolving Credit Facility under Order G-145-09; however, denied PNG’s request to have $10 million of the Revolving Credit Facility available for non‑regulated business; and

 

D.      On December 3, 2009 the Commission approved PNG (N.E.) to enter into the PNG Revolving Credit Facility with PNG in the principal amount of $12 million under Order G-146-09; and

 

E.       On June 3, 2010, PNG (N.E.) applied to the Commission for approval to increase the allowable indebtedness under the PNG Revolving Credit Facility from $12 million approved under Order G-146-09 to $16.8 million (the Application); and

 

F.       On June 8, 2010 the Commission issued an Information Request, which PNG responded to on June 14, 2010; and

 

G.     The Commission has reviewed the Application and supporting material and finds that approval of the request by PNG (N.E.) to increase the principal indebtedness under the PNG Revolving Credit Facility to be in the public interest.

 

 

NOW THEREFORE pursuant to section 50 of the Act, the Commission hereby grants approval for PNG (N.E.) to enter into and incur indebtedness under the PNG Revolving Credit Facility up to the principal amount of $16.8 million under the same financing term and conditions as set forth in the Application approved under OrderG-146-09.
